The most important change happens in the soundboard, bridges, strings, and action parts that experience constant micro-vibration.
In many grand pianos, spruce soundboards slowly lose residual internal stress. This can improve vibrational freedom and energy transfer.
As the board becomes more responsive, low, middle, and upper frequencies may blend with greater complexity.
Strings also settle over time. Their speaking length, tension behavior, and interaction with the bridge become more stable after repeated tuning cycles.
Hammer felt changes too. It compacts through use, altering the contact between felt and string.
That change can increase brilliance, reduce harshness, or expose unevenness, depending on maintenance quality.
Not every aging effect is positive. Cracks, excessive dryness, loose tuning pins, and worn action geometry can also reduce tonal richness.
So when people say older grand pianos sound richer, they usually mean well-built, well-maintained instruments that matured under stable conditions.
The soundboard is the acoustic heart of grand pianos. Without it, strings alone would produce limited volume and color.
When hammers strike strings, vibration travels through the bridge into the spruce board. The board amplifies those vibrations into audible tone.
Over time, repeated excitation can help the board respond more efficiently across a wider frequency range.
This is one reason seasoned grand pianos often show a more layered tonal palette than newer instruments.

No. Age alone does not guarantee a superior voice. Quality of design, materials, maintenance, and climate history matter far more.
A neglected older instrument may sound thin, uneven, or dull. A newer premium instrument may sound clearer, more balanced, and more powerful.
The better question is whether grand pianos have matured constructively or deteriorated structurally.
Constructive maturity usually includes stable tuning, responsive action, broad dynamic control, and a singing sustain.
Deterioration often shows up as buzzing, poor repetition, false beats, uneven voicing, weak bass, or a shallow treble.

Grand pianos do not mature well through neglect. Their evolving tone depends on regulation, voicing, tuning, cleaning, and environmental control.
Regular tuning keeps string relationships stable. This supports cleaner resonance and more coherent overtones.
Voicing matters because hammer felt naturally hardens and grooves with use. Skilled needling or reshaping can preserve warmth and control brightness.
Action regulation keeps touch and timing even. When escapement, let-off, drop, and key balance drift, tone quality often suffers too.
Playing habits also influence development. Consistent, varied playing helps grand pianos vibrate across different registers and dynamic levels.
Long silence can leave the tone feeling stiff. Extreme force can compress hammers too aggressively.

One myth says every old piano becomes warm and noble. In reality, poor storage can destroy tonal potential.
Another myth says brightness means youth while warmth means age. Tonal character depends on scale design, voicing, room acoustics, and repertoire.
Some also believe rarely played grand pianos stay pristine. Mechanically, unused parts can stiffen, and tonal response may become less lively.
A further mistake is judging only by brand reputation. Even celebrated grand pianos vary significantly according to care history.
A better approach combines listening, technical inspection, and context. Consider room size, musical purpose, maintenance records, and long-term service needs.
